SGroup Engagements Session Explores "The Green Agenda" and the Social Mission of Universities

6 February 2025

On February 6th, 2025, the SGroup – Universities in Europe hosted another inspiring edition of its Engagements series, bringing together experts from academia and industry to discuss "The Green Agenda: Social Mission, Sustainability, and Environmentalism." 

This 90-minute online session featured a panel of distinguished speakers who shared their insights on the crucial role universities play in driving sustainability and environmental responsibility. The event was moderated by Adina Fodor (Babeș-Bolyai University) and welcomed:

  • Professor Bálint MARKÓ – Vice-Rector, Babeș-Bolyai University
  • Mr. Brian GORMLEY – Head of Sustainability Education, TU Dublin
  • Alexandra HUGHES – TTSMU
  • Cecilia CHRISTERSSON – TTSMU
